On 06/16/2015 11:28 PM, Yuan Sun wrote:
>   ID-outside-ns is interpreted according to which process is opening
> the file. If the process opening the file is in the same user namespace
> as the process PID, then ID-outside-ns is defined with respect to the
> parent user namespace. If the process opening the file is in a different
> user namespace, then ID-outside-ns is defined with respect to the user
> namespace of the process opening the file.
>   If kernel version >= 3.19.0, the case will ignore the git check.
> 
> Signed-off-by: Yuan Sun <sunyu...@huawei.com>

Hi,

there is one problem in v3 with synchronization.
Problem is that child2 can start checking it's uid/gid sooner than
main sets the mapping.

I have attached my idea for possible fix, comments about changes I made are 
below.

+ * Verify that:
+ * /proc/PID/uid_map and /proc/PID/gid_map contains three values separated by
+ * white space:
+ * ID-inside-ns   ID-outside-ns   length
+ *
+ * ID-outside-ns is interpreted according to which process is opening the file.
+ * If the process opening the file is in the same user namespace as the process
+ * PID, then ID-outside-ns is defined with respect to the parent user namespace.
+ * If the process opening the file is in a different user namespace, then
+ * ID-outside-ns is defined with respect to the user namespace of the process
+ * opening the file.
+ *
+ * GID check is skipped if setgroups is allowed, see kernel commits:
+ *
+ *   commit 9cc46516ddf497ea16e8d7cb986ae03a0f6b92f8
+ *   Author: Eric W. Biederman <ebied...@xmission.com>
+ *   Date:   Tue Dec 2 12:27:26 2014 -0600
+ *     userns: Add a knob to disable setgroups on a per user namespace basis
+ *
+ *   commit 66d2f338ee4c449396b6f99f5e75cd18eb6df272
+ *   Author: Eric W. Biederman <ebied...@xmission.com>
+ *   Date:   Fri Dec 5 19:36:04 2014 -0600
+ *     userns: Allow setting gid_maps without privilege when setgroups is disabled
+ *
+ */
